The Importance of Creativity in Parkour
While technical skills are essential, creativity allows athletes to craft unique and memorable performances. It encourages them to push boundaries, experiment with new tricks, and develop personalized styles that reflect their personality. Judges increasingly value originality, making creativity a key factor in scoring.
How Creativity Enhances Performance
- Innovative Tricks: Introducing new combos can surprise judges and spectators alike.
- Personal Style: Expressing individuality through movement sets athletes apart.
- Storytelling: Creating routines that tell a story or evoke emotion adds depth.
- Adaptability: Incorporating elements from other disciplines shows versatility.

Tips for Developing Creativity
- Practice Freestyle: Dedicate time to improvisation to discover new moves.
- Study Others: Watch diverse performances to inspire ideas.
- Experiment: Don’t be afraid to try unconventional tricks or sequences.
- Reflect: Review recordings to identify what feels unique and natural.
